About Mustafa Karabiyik

Mustafa Karabiyik is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 44 papers that have together received 717 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research (16 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(15 papers) and Metamaterials and Metasurfaces Applications (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(270 citations), Biomedical Engineering (360 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(417 citations). Mustafa Karabiyik has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Netherlands and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Nezih Pala, Raju Sinha, Arash Ahmadivand, Burak Gerislioglu, Phani Kiran Vabbina, M. S. Shur, Santanu Das, Nitin Choudhary, Wonbong Choi and B. Imran Akca.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Optics Letters.
